About the role

  • We are seeking a Senior Territory Manager for our Central Texas Territory.
  • This individual will be responsible for agency relationships and business development, with a strong focus on the marketing of GUARD’s products and developing the territory across their assigned footprint.
  • This role requires routine travel within their assigned territory and outside of the territory on occasion.
  • Develop and maintain profitable, meaningful relationships with agency partners by ensuring they are well-trained and understand the company’s appetite, guidelines and initiatives.
  • Actively engage agency partners to drive submission activity and achieve profitable growth and business mix goals.
  • Consistent execution of day-to-day sales process and activities using a disciplined sales process by leveraging tools and metrics that reinforces the focus on agency relationships.
  • Build strong working relationships with distribution leadership and internal stakeholders, taking a collaborative approach to identify and pursue growth opportunities, optimize territory alignment, and strategically expand across the territory.
  • Analyze agency performance, market trends and competitor activity to inform tactical decisions and ensure ongoing alignment with GUARD’s underwriting appetite and distribution objectives.

Requirements

  • Ideal candidate has a minimum of 3+ years territory management and/or field underwriting experience
  • Positive face of the organization and a “can-do” attitude
  • Proven track record of developing and maintaining strong agency partnerships and obtaining sales results
  • Solid technical knowledge of commercial insurance, including Worker’s Compensation, Businessowners’, Commercial Auto, and Umbrella
  • Strong familiarity with the Central TX area and its agency networks, market conditions, and competitive landscape
  • Excellent sales acumen and desire to make a difference
  • Excellent communication, presentation and negotiation skills
  • Bachelor's degree preferred
  • Ability and willingness to travel regularly throughout the region by both car and air
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Excel; experience with Power BI is a plus
